BOILING SPRINGS, N.C. (February 13, 2022) – Howard University women's lacrosse team fell on the road at Gardner-Webb (GWU), 18-6, and dropped to 0-2 on the young season.
Graduate
Lailah Robey (Chesapeake Beach, Md.) and newcomer
Taylor Matthews (Tampa, Fla.) each registered a pair of goals in the loss.
Trailing, 2-0, Robey got HU on the board, thanks to an assist from third-year Bison
Quai Skeete-Ridley (New Carrollton, Md.), 2-1.
GWU responded with six unanswered goals, but Matthews closed out the quarter with her first goal of the afternoon, 8-2.
Gardner-Webb held the Bison scoreless in the second period while extending its lead to double-digits before intermission, 13-2.
After halftime, HU outscored GWU in the third period, 3-1, but Gardner-Webb finished the contest on a 4-1 run to win, 18-6.
Freshman goalkeeper
Anya Waller (King of Prussia, Pa.) had eight saves in the loss.
